Using external monitor, lid closure disable should disable laptop screen. #42

Open GoogleCodeExporter opened 9 years ago

GoogleCodeExporter commented 9 years ago
This is not really a serious problem, but I would really like it if when I'm 
using my external monitor and I close the lid of the laptop, if the internal 
LCD screen would automatically disable so I wouldn't need to worry about 
windows or my cursor moving to the closed screen. It works that way in W7.  

What version of the product are you using? On what operating system?
I'm using VPCF11JFX with Kernel 2.6.35 on ubuntu 10.10

Please provide any additional information below.
I tried changing the power settings to have the laptop screen go blank upon lid 
closure, but it still counts as an active screen. It seems much of the display 
detection is not very robust, as unplugging the HDMI cable does not 
automatically disable the external monitor registering as an active screen 
either.
